A known quirk with Linux-based Cisco IOL images is the "keepalive bug." If an interface is connected to another device and the link goes down, or under heavy traffic, interfaces can randomly transition to an err-disabled or up/down state.

Since IOU runs as a native Linux process, it requires far fewer resources than IOSv (QEMU). This enables simulations of 20+ routers on a modest laptop.

: Because it runs natively on x86 CPUs, any feature requiring specialized hardware Application-Specific Integrated Circuits (ASICs)—such as certain hardware-based Quality of Service (QoS) queuing mechanisms or NetFlow implementations—may behave unexpectedly or fail to execute.
